FAMILY DEVELOPMENT PROGRAM

 

"A partnership that focuses on the strengths of the family/individual to develop their personal path to self reliance."

 

The Family Development Program provides intensive and customized case management services to a diverse population of families, couples, and individuals.  This partnership is an ongoing process built upon respect.

 

The family/individual, with the guidance of their Life Coach, determines what changes will improve their quality of life with an emphasis on employment and creates a plan of action to achieve those changes.

 

This self-directed plan uses the strengths of the family/individual to move forward in their journey toward their employment. Each plan is structured to find the best solutions, and community resources are used as necessary to attain the desired outcome.  The purpose of the program is long-term growth rather than emergency-based assistance.

CENTRO PROGRAM

 

The CENTRO Program, located in Vista and operated by Community Housing Works, provides transitional housing for 20 formerly homeless families.  CENTRO assists families to achieve self-sufficiency and stability, and to secure permanent, affordable housing upon program graduation.

 

The program provides families with up to 24 months of housing assistance, allowing the opportunity to increase skills, partly through family participation in Lifeline's case management program.  The case management process respects a family's ability to make wise choices and solve problems, and supports and guides the family towards greater self-sufficiency.

 

Lifeline also provides the CENTRO Program with client outreach and assessment, case management, emergency assistance, landlord/tenant mediation, legal assistance, mental health counseling, dispute resolution, life skills classes, parenting classes, and more.

COMMUNITY SERVICES FOR FAMILIES PROGRAM

 

The Community Services for Families Program is a collaborative effort of many agencies: North County Lifeline, Home Start, YMCA Kinship, Indian Health Council, Friends & Family Community Connection, Straight from the Heart, and others.  The program offers a network of community-based support services to help at-risk families achieve improved well-being.
